Identity (2006) is a fascinating dive into the lives of three adult video performers, each grappling with their own sense of self amid the complexities of their careers. The tone is introspective, often lingering on the quiet moments that reveal the characters' vulnerabilities. It's not just about the adult industry; it explores broader themes of identity and societal perception. The pacing feels almost meditative at times, allowing you to absorb their stories without rushing. The interviews are raw and honest, showcasing performances that feel genuine rather than scripted. What makes it distinctive is the way it blurs the line between public persona and private self, making you ponder how we all construct our identities, in whatever field we operate.
